my xj was auto on 4:10s and 34s.. it sucked. sucked gas, and sucked on power.

my zj was on 4:56s and 35s. i got about 12-13 mpg, but it had *****. but that was prob due to the 5.9 swap lol.

so 35s on an auto xj = 4:88s for sure. manual = 4:56.

i understand why you did 4:10s tho.. i did the exact same thing when i built my xj w/an 8.8
